Update: Deceased identified in shooting

Dec. 30 Update: The deceased has been identified as Jabari Cephus, 20. Officers have identified a subject of interest in the Sunday night shooting, which occurred in the parking lot of the Regency at Dell Ranch apartment complex. The preliminary investigation indicates this was a dispute between two subjects who knew each other. At this time, it is believed that there is not a continuing threat to the public.

The investigation is ongoing. If you have any information about this incident, contact Sgt. Blake Bearden at bbearden@roundrocktexas.gov.

The Round Rock Fire Department, Williamson County EMS, Williamson County Sheriff’s Office, and Pflugerville Police Department provided assistance.

Original Post: Shortly after 10 p.m. Sunday, Dec. 29, officers responded to a report of gunshots in the 600 block of Louis Henna Blvd. One male subject was found with what appear to be gunshot wounds and was transported to the hospital where he was pronounced dead. He has not yet been positively identified. Two other subjects were detained at the scene. It is unknown what their involvement is. The scene has been secured and the investigation is ongoing.
